Skip to main content
TopDealsNet

Back to all posts

6 Best AI Code Review Tool in 2025

Published on
4 min read
6 Best AI Code Review Tool in 2025 image

Best AI Code Review Tool in November 2025

1 Windsurf

Windsurf

  • AI that writes clean & reliable code
  • AI that understands your whole project
  • Deep project awareness
  • Level up your development instantly
TRY NOW
2 DeepCode

DeepCode

  • AI-powered code reviews
  • Supports multiple languages
  • Provides real-time collaboration
  • Integrates with popular IDEs
  • Continuously learns from new data
TRY NOW
3 Codacy

Codacy

  • Automated code quality checks
  • Supports over 40 programming languages
  • Identifies security vulnerabilities
  • Customizable code patterns
  • Seamless integration with Git
TRY NOW
4 Codota

Codota

  • AI-driven code completion
  • Context-aware recommendations
  • Integrated with IDEs like IntelliJ and Eclipse
  • Supports Java, JavaScript, and TypeScript
  • Team collaboration features
TRY NOW
5 Snyk

Snyk

  • Finds and fixes vulnerabilities in code
  • Supports open source and container security
  • Provides actionable insights
  • Integrates with CI/CD pipelines
  • Real-time security notifications
TRY NOW
6 Kite

Kite

  • AI-powered autocomplete for Python
  • Extensive documentation snippets
  • Smart line-of-code completions
  • Works with popular editors like VS Code and Sublime
  • Cloudless, runs locally for privacy
TRY NOW
+
ONE MORE?

In recent years, the evolution of technology has led to significant advancements in the way software development is carried out. One such innovation is the development of AI code review tools. As the demand for faster and more efficient software development grows, AI-powered code review tools are becoming indispensable. They not only help in identifying potential code issues but also enhance the overall quality of the software. In this article, we'll provide a comprehensive guide on the best practices for choosing an AI code review tool that meets your needs.

What is an AI Code Review Tool?

AI code review tools are software solutions that use artificial intelligence to analyze, review, and improve code quality. They assist developers by automatically identifying bugs, code smells, and other quality issues in the codebase. These tools leverage machine learning algorithms to adapt and provide suggestions for optimizing code structure and efficiency.

Key Features to Look for in an AI Code Review Tool

When evaluating AI code review tools, considering certain key features can help ensure you make a wise choice:

1. Accuracy and Precision

The tool should be adept at accurately identifying code issues without generating false positives. This ensures developers can trust its recommendations and can efficiently address genuine problems without being overwhelmed by unnecessary alerts.

2. Customizability

The ability to customize the tool to fit the specific coding standards and practices of your organization is crucial. Look for tools that offer flexibility in configuration, such as customized rule sets or language support expansion.

3. Scalability

A good AI code review tool should be scalable to accommodate the growing size and complexity of your projects. It should efficiently handle large codebases without compromising performance or accuracy.

4. Integration Capabilities

The tool should seamlessly integrate with existing development workflows and tools, such as version control systems, build pipelines, and IDEs. Smooth integration helps in maintaining developers' productivity.

5. Real-time Feedback

Real-time feedback is essential for developers to make on-the-spot corrections and improvements. The tool should provide suggestions and analysis as the code is being written or modified, facilitating immediate improvements.

6. Security Analysis

In addition to syntax and style improvements, the tool should also perform thorough security analysis, helping safeguard the code against vulnerabilities and attacks.

How to Choose the Best AI Code Review Tool

Selecting the best AI code review tool involves careful consideration of various factors beyond just features. Here are some steps to guide you in making an informed decision:

Conduct a Needs Assessment

Identify the specific needs and challenges within your development process. This may include considering the programming languages you use, the size of the team, and the typical scope of your projects.

Trial Periods and Demos

Take advantage of free trials or demos offered by vendors to test the tool in your unique environment. This hands-on experience is invaluable in assessing the tool's effectiveness.

Budget Considerations

Evaluate the cost of the tool against its features and the value it brings to your organization. While it's important to stay within budget, it's equally important to choose a tool that maximally benefits your development process.

Reviews and Community Feedback

Research reviews and feedback from other users and communities. Real-world experiences can provide insights into a tool's strengths and weaknesses, helping guide your selection.

Vendor Support and Documentation

Ensure that the tool comes with extensive documentation and responsive customer support. Reliable support can significantly impact your experience and satisfaction with the tool.

Conclusion

Investing in the right AI code review tool can substantially enhance your software development lifecycle by boosting code quality and developer productivity. By focusing on accuracy, integration capabilities, scalability, and other key features, you can select a tool that best aligns with your organization's needs. As AI continues to evolve, so too will the capabilities of these tools, making them an essential asset in any developer’s toolkit.


If you are also interested in smart home appliances, consider checking out top air fryer oven sale and find the best air conditioner sales to enhance your home environment.